A Registered Nurse position fills in shifts across various programs and facilities throughout the agency. The Registered Nurse provides high-quality, compassionate nursing care to patients in a variety of clinical settings. This position must adapt quickly to different work environments, collaborate with interdisciplinary teams, and demonstrate strong clinical and critical thinking skills.
Minimum Education: Associate Degree in Nursing
Preferences: Bachelor's Degree in Nursing
Experience: One (1) year Experience in Clinical Nursing (Psychiatric, Med-Surg, ER, Home Health, etc)
License/Certifications: Registered Nurse, BLS (if needed, BLS must be obtained during onboarding process)
